Cognition of and Demand for Education and Teaching in Medical Statistics in China: A Systematic Review and Meta-Analysis

Background Although a substantial number of studies focus on the teaching and application of medical statistics in China, few studies comprehensively evaluate the recognition of and demand for medical statistics. In addition, the results of these various studies differ and are insufficiently comprehensive and systematic. Objectives This investigation aimed to evaluate the general cognition of and demand for medical statistics by undergraduates, graduates, and medical staff in China. Methods We performed a comprehensive database search related to the cognition of and demand for medical statistics from January 2007 to July 2014 and conducted a meta-analysis of non-controlled studies with sub-group analysis for undergraduates, graduates, and medical staff. Results There are substantial differences with respect to the cognition of theory in medical statistics among undergraduates (73.5%), graduates (60.7%), and medical staff (39.6%). The demand for theory in medical statistics is high among graduates (94.6%), undergraduates (86.1%), and medical staff (88.3%). Regarding specific statistical methods, the cognition of basic statistical methods is higher than of advanced statistical methods. The demand for certain advanced statistical methods, including (but not limited to) multiple analysis of variance (ANOVA), multiple linear regression, and logistic regression, is higher than that for basic statistical methods. The use rates of the Statistical Package for the Social Sciences (SPSS) software and statistical analysis software (SAS) are only 55% and 15%, respectively. Conclusion The overall statistical competence of undergraduates, graduates, and medical staff is insufficient, and their ability to practically apply their statistical knowledge is limited, which constitutes an unsatisfactory state of affairs for medical statistics education. Because the demand for skills in this area is increasing, the need to reform medical statistics education in China has become urgent.

背景 尽管国内已有大量研究聚焦于医学统计学的教学与应用,但鲜有研究能够全面评估本科生、研究生及医务人员对医学统计学的认知水平与实际需求。此外,现有同类研究的结论存在差异,且整体不够全面系统。 目的 本研究旨在评估我国本科生、研究生及医务人员对医学统计学的整体认知水平与实际需求。 方法 本研究检索了2007年1月至2014年7月期间所有与医学统计学认知及需求相关的文献,并针对本科生、研究生及医务人员群体,对非对照研究开展荟萃分析与亚组分析。 结果 本科生、研究生及医务人员对医学统计学理论的认知率分别为73.5%、60.7%与39.6%,三者存在显著差异;三类群体对医学统计学理论的需求率均较高,其中研究生为94.6%,本科生为86.1%,医务人员为88.3%。就具体统计方法而言,受试者对基础统计方法的认知率高于高级统计方法;但针对多元方差分析(ANOVA)、多元线性回归及logistic回归等部分高级统计方法的需求率,却高于基础统计方法。社会科学统计软件包(Statistical Package for the Social Sciences, SPSS)与统计分析系统(Statistical Analysis System, SAS)的使用率仅分别为55%与15%。 结论 我国本科生、研究生及医务人员的整体统计能力仍存在不足,且统计学知识的实际应用能力有限,这一现状对医学统计学教育而言难言理想。随着该领域技能需求的持续增长,我国医学统计学教育改革的紧迫性日益凸显。
